This paper examines a number of very common themes in Islamic art and relates them to its nature, sources, principles, and artistic character. Particular attention is paid to the relationship between Islam and art and to determing the extent to which Islam as a faith has influenced Islamic art. As one can hardly pass over in silence the ban on representing persons, when dealing with Islamic art as a phenomenon, that too is discussed at the appropriate point in the paper. This paper involves no attempt to offer final answers, the author’s hope being to initiate dialogue on themes affecting Islamic art. A satisfactory treatment of the topics of the subsections would require a series of dedicated studies.
